IBM Sterling Partner Engagement Manager 6.2.2 could allow a local attacker to obtain sensitive information when a detailed technical error message is returned. IBM X-Force ID: 230933.

CVE-2022-35640 has been classified as a medium severity vulnerability due to its potential impact on sensitive information exposure.
To mitigate CVE-2022-35640, users should apply the latest security patches provided by IBM for Sterling Partner Engagement Manager 6.2.2.
CVE-2022-35640 affects IBM Sterling Partner Engagement Manager versions up to and including 6.2.2.
CVE-2022-35640 requires local access, meaning a local attacker must exploit the vulnerability to obtain the sensitive information.
CVE-2022-35640 could allow attackers to obtain sensitive information through detailed error messages returned by the system.
